Can we get a response on re-rendering issue in WoW?

Ever since a couple months ago every few hours (or when i open the collections tab, that triggers it almost every time) my game freezes for about 5 seconds, and then every single texture in the game bugs out and re-renders. Takes about 15-20 sec to go back to normal. It happens inside arenas, inside dungeons, anywhere. It’s getting exhausting.

No, it’s not my pc. No, it’s not my GPU. Doesn’t happen on any other game, my 2nd monitor keeps showing the same image without issues while this is happening so it’s clearly not a “gpu getting reset” issue.

I’ve reinstalled and updated every gpu driver, ive reinstalled wow, ive updated windows, ive tried dx11 and dx12. The re-rendering is actually a driver crash that was recoverable I am running February 13th NVIDIA drivers and have zero issues soon as I put the new ones on my machine my machine starts having GPU issues. Game ready drivers are just for the game that they mention in the description they’re not tested with any other game release versions of the drivers or actually tested with other games and software

TL;DR: Your CPU is below the requirements for WoW but this is likely related to the GPU.

In this case, it seems the issue is more driver-focused, so I recommend following Northernlite’s advice above.

For future issues, keep in mind that the CPU launched in 2019 and the clockspeeds of all i5-9400 variants are just under the minimum 3.0GHz processor requirements for WoW. That doesn’t mean you can’t run WoW (obviously), but you might run into some hiccups that Blizzard may not be able to address.
